The NHS is a ‘professional bureaucracy’ in which front-line clinical staff have a large measure of control and influence over day-to-day decision-making, which is greater than that of staff in formal positions of authority. As a result, directives issued ‘from above’ can have limited impact and may be resisted. WebNationally, the NHS fleet and business travel account for around 4% of the NHS Carbon footprint, but as a community trust Sussex Community NHS Foundation Trust’s (SCFT) is closer to 5.5%. Travel is a necessary part of its work in delivering care out in the community, seeing patients in their homes. A geographically diverse region means ... how long can cauliflower last in fridge

WebThe RCGP Green Impact for Health toolkit can be used by GP practices to make their practice as environmentally friendly as possible. Greener Practice is a group and website developed by GPs in Sheffield to help GPs everywhere practice sustainably. There is a local Bristol branch which meets regularly to share ideas and help practices use the ...
